The NFL Draft kicks off this week with the first round happening on Thursday, April 23rd, but is it really the NFL Draft if we can't boo Roger Goodell?

All 32 teams will be making their draft picks from remote locations. For a lot of fans, not only do they look forward to who their favorite team picks, they're also looking forward to seeing the hats and of course, the booing! Commissioner Roger Goodell recently spoke on what this year's draft is going to look like. He says, "you're going to have to show up and watch! I will say this: It’s a big part of the draft. I personally love the engagement with our fans. That [booing] is included. For us, we had to think through, ‘How are we going to bring the fans into the event? How are we going to allow the boo to be a part of the event as it has been in the past?’” Click HERE to hear what else he had to say.
